Michael W. Gish, M.D.
Specializing in sports medicine and arthroscopic surgery.
Dr. Gish is fellowship-trained in Sports Medicine and holds an additional subspecialty certificate in the field of Orthopedic Sports Medicine. During his training he was assistant team physician to all of Cleveland's pro sports teams, including the Browns, Indians, and Cavaliers. With expertise in all areas of sports medicine, he has a special interest in ACL reconstruction and arthroscopic shoulder surgery, including surgery for shoulder instability and rotator cuff repair. |
